Randstad is currently seeking an Executive Assistant with extensive experience working with leadership team. It is a 3 months contract, the role is based in Geelong. Work with the government organisation at an attractive pay rate of $57.83/hr+ super.

The ideal candidate will be a proactive professional capable of managing multiple tasks, anticipating needs, and maintaining confidentiality in a fast-paced corporate environment. This role requires exceptional communication skills, attention to detail, and the ability to prioritise and execute tasks with minimal supervision. The Executive Assistant will play a critical role in facilitating smooth operations and enhancing productivity within the organisation.

Responsibilities:

- Provide comprehensive administrative support to the executive team, including calendar management, scheduling meetings, travel arrangements, and expense reporting.
- Act as a central point of contact, effectively managing all incoming communication and correspondence on behalf of the executives.
- Prepare and edit professional documents, presentations, and reports, ensuring accuracy and adherence to organisational standards.
- Coordinate and facilitate meetings, including agenda preparation, minute-taking, and distribution of meeting materials.
- Conduct research, compile data, and prepare briefing documents to support executive decision-making and strategic initiatives.
- Maintain confidential and sensitive information, exercising discretion and professionalism at all times.
- Assist in project management by tracking deliverable, deadlines, and milestones, and providing regular progress updates to the executives.
- Coordinate and organise internal and external events, conferences, and business functions, including logistics, venue arrangements, and catering.
- Serve as a liaison between executives and internal/external stakeholders, maintaining positive relationships and ensuring effective communication.
- Anticipate the needs of executives and proactively identify opportunities to enhance their efficiency and productivity.

What you'll need to succeed

- Proven experience as an executive assistant or in a similar administrative role supporting senior management.
- Strong organisational and multitasking skills, with the ability to prioritise tasks and meet deadlines in a fast-paced environment.
- Excellent written and verbal communication skills, with exceptional attention to detail and accuracy.
- Proficient in using productivity tools, such as MS Office Suite (Word, Excel, PowerPoint, Outlook), and experience with calendar and project management software.
- Discretion and ability to handle confidential information with professionalism and integrity.
- Strong interpersonal skills, with the ability to build effective working relationships with individuals at all levels.
- Proactive and self-motivated with the ability to work independently and take initiative.
- Flexibility and adaptability to changing priorities and demands.
- Strong problem-solving skills and the ability to think critically and make sound decisions.
- Bachelor's degree in business administration or a related field is preferred.
